-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
电子技术课程设计报告书
课题名称 交通信号灯控制系统 姓 名 王朝 学 号 1314080213 院、系、部 光电工程系 专 业 电子信息科学与技术 指导教师 高坤
2015年 5 月 25日
一、设计任务及要求:
设计任务:
设计一个十字路口交通灯信号控制器1. 十字路口设有红、黄、绿、左拐指示灯;有数字显示通行时间,以秒单位作减法计数。2. 主、支干道交替通行,主干道每次绿灯亮40S,左拐指示灯15S;支干道每次绿灯亮20S,左拐指示灯亮10S。3. 每次绿灯变左拐时,黄灯先亮5S(此时另一干道上的红灯不变),每次左拐指示变红灯时,黄灯先亮5S(此时另一干道上的红灯不变)。4. 当主、支干道任意干道出现特殊情况时,进入特殊运行状态,两干道上所有车辆都禁止通行,红灯全亮,时钟停止工作。. 要求主、支干道通行时间及黄灯亮的时间均可在0~99S内任意设定。十字路口设有红、黄、绿、左拐指示灯;有数字显示通行时间,以秒单位作减法计数。主、支干道交替通行,主干道每次绿灯亮40S,左拐指示灯15S;支干道每次绿灯亮20S,左拐指示灯亮10S。每次绿灯变左拐时,黄灯先亮5S(此时另一干道上的红灯不变),每次左拐指示变红灯时,黄灯先亮5S(此时另一干道上的红灯不变)。当主、支干道任意干道出现特殊情况时,进入特殊运行状态,两干道上所有车辆都禁止通行,红灯全亮,时钟停止工作。要求主、支干道通行时间及黄灯亮的时间均可在0~99S内任意设定。
图1 路口交通指挥系统示意图
设主干道通行时间为a1,干道通行时间为a2,主、支干道黄等的时间均为a3,按主支干道通行的时间来看,设置a1﹥a2﹥a3。系统工作流程图如图所示。
交通灯控制系统的组成框图如图.所示。状态控制器主要用于纪录十字路口交通灯的工作状态,通过状态译码器分别点亮相应状态的信号灯。秒信号发生器产生整个定时系统的时基脉冲,通过减法计数器对秒脉冲减计数,达到控制每一种工作状态的持续时间。减法计数器的回零脉冲使状态控制器完成状态转换,同时状态译码器根据系统下一个工作状态决定计数器下一次减计数的初始值。减法计数器的状态由BCD译码器译码、数码管显示。在黄灯亮期间,状态译码器将秒脉冲引入红灯控制电路,使红灯闪烁。
图 交通灯控制系统的组成框图
十字路口车辆运行情况只有4种可能:1)设开始时主干道通行,支干道不通行,这种情况下主绿灯和支红灯亮,持续时间为40s。2)40s后,主干道停车,支干道仍不通行,这种情况下主黄灯和支红灯亮,持续时间为5s。3)5s后,主干道不通行,支干道通行,这种情况下主红灯和支绿灯亮,持续时间为20s。4)50s后,主干道仍不通行,支干道停车,这种情况下主红灯和支黄灯亮,持续时间为5s。5s后又回到第一种情况,如此循环反复。因此,要求主控制电路也有4种状态,设这4种状态依次为:S0、S1、S2、S3。状态转换图如图所示。
3.2计数器的作用
计数器的作用有二:一是根据主干道和支干道车辆运行时间以及黄灯切换时间的要求,进行40s、20s、5s 3种方式的计数;二是向主控制器发出状态转换信号,主控制器根据状态转换信号进行状态转换。
3.3计数器的工作情况
计数器除需要秒脉冲作时钟信号外,还应受主控制器的状态控制。计数器的工作情况为:计数器在主控制器进入状态S0时开始70s计数;40s后产生归零脉冲,并向主控制器发出状态转换信号,使计数器归零,主控制器进入状态S1,计数器开始5s计数;5s后又产生归零脉冲,并向主控制器发出状态转换信号,使计数器归零,主控制器进入状态S2,计数器开始20s计数;20s后也产生归零脉冲,并向主控制器发出状态转换信号,使计数器归零,主控制器进入状态S3,计数器又开始5s计数;5s后同样产生归零脉冲,并向主控制器发出状态转换信号,使计数器归零,主控制器回到状态S0,开始新一轮循环。
根据以上分析,设40s、20s、5s计数的归零信号分别为A、B、C,则计数器的归零信号L为:
L=A+B+C
其中:
A=S0 QC2= QC2
B=S2 QB2 QA2= QB2 QA2
C=S1 QB1 QA1+S3 QB1QA1= X0 QB1 QA1
考虑到主控制器的状态转换为下降沿触发,将L取反后送到主控制器的CP端作为主控制器的状态转换信号。可选用集成异步十进制加法记数器(74LS90)。。
3.4控制信号灯的译码电路的真值表
主、支干道上红、黄、绿信号灯的状态主要取决于状态控制器的输出状态。它们之间的关系见真值表4.1。对于信号灯的状态,“1”表示灯亮,“0”表示灯灭。
信号灯信号的状态
状态控制器输出 主干道信号灯 支干道信号灯 Q2
文档评论(0)